Output d15f31c037d8b7f5bbd9226b6688aacf3786570f212b3d9241eb6e658d9db378:0

value
3488885560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cdfd2ab03f1914a9c8ec4e3f28c7724a0ad1f11 OP_EQUAL
address
3D5HqpWftMBCYfUK8AArHycKgrGBka8qjX
transaction
d15f31c037d8b7f5bbd9226b6688aacf3786570f212b3d9241eb6e658d9db378
confirmations
362838
spent
true